Libgcrypt could be made to expose sensitive information.. =========================================================================Ubuntu Security Notice USN-4236-2 January 14, 2020 libgcrypt20 vulnerability ========================================================================= A security issue affects these releases of Ubuntu and its derivatives: - Ubuntu 16.04 LTS Summary: Libgcrypt could be made to expose sensitive information. Software Description: - libgcrypt20: LGPL Crypto library Details: USN-4236-1 fixed a vulnerability in Libgcrypt. This update provides the corresponding fix for Ubuntu 16.04 LTS. Original advisory details: It was discovered that Libgcrypt was susceptible to a ECDSA timing attack. An attacker could possibly use this attack to recover sensitive information. Update instructions: The problem can be corrected by updating your system to the following package versions: Ubuntu 16.04 LTS: libgcrypt20 1.6.5-2ubuntu0.6 In general, a standard system update will make all the necessary changes.
